When the wife and I had it we tried a lot of food to see what we could taste. Weird results - bland thing like refried beans I could taste fine. Tortillas - nope. Wasabi - nope. I figured the wasabi would still take my breath away, but it was as if I put water in my mouth. Really crazy. We tried some pie - I could taste sweet, but couldn't tell you what kind of pie it was.

Mine was the same way. I could taste sweet and spicy flavors but nothing else. It was really weird biting into a rib or steak and not tasting anything other than a subtle amount of spices.

Scented candles and hand soap were weird too. I would see them burning or washing my hands but absolutely no hint of any aroma coming from them. It did encourage me to double check batteries in all the smoke detectors though once I realized I couldnt smell smoke if something started to burn.
